Realization of Target Position Changing On-The-Fly for Intelligent Motion Control Applications

Article Preview

Abstract:

This paper presents an algorithm of S-curve profile velocity planning with prediction of deceleration distance dynamically, extended functions including target position or target speed change on-the-fly, motion pausing and resuming are addressed. The algorithm is implemented for high performance multiple axes motion controller where complex paths must be employed for each axis to obtain smooth acceleration, speed, position shapes and target position or speed will be changed during moving to meet the requirement of processing. Application that requires the ability to change the endpoint or moving speed without completing the previous move are applied in varied industrial equipment such as SMT, AOI, product lines, etc.

You might also be interested in these eBooks

Info:

Periodical:

Pages:

1602-1607

Citation:

Online since:

December 2012

Export:

Price:

Permissions CCC:

Permissions PLS:

Сopyright:

© 2013 Trans Tech Publications Ltd. All Rights Reserved

Share:

Citation:

[1] Al-Ayasrah O., Alukaidey T., Pissanidis G.. Mixed Signal DSP Based Multi Task Motion Control System using External FPGA Structural Design[J]. 2005 Annual IEEE INDICON, 2005 pp.419-422

DOI: 10.1109/indcon.2005.1590203

Google Scholar

[2] S. S. Kim and S. Jung, "Development of a general purpose motion controllerusing a field programmable gate array," ICCAS, 2003, p.360–365.

Google Scholar

[3] M. Krips, T. Lammert, and A. Kummert, FPGA implementation of aneural network for a real-time hand tracking system, in Proc. 1st IEEE Int. Workshop on Electron. Des., Test, Appl., 2002, p.313–317.

DOI: 10.1109/delta.2002.994637

Google Scholar

[4] M. Cristea, J. Khor, and M. McCormick, FPGA fuzzy logic controller for variable speed generators, in Proc. IEEE Int. Conf. Control Appl.,2001, p.301–304.

DOI: 10.1109/cca.2001.973881

Google Scholar

[5] A. K. Oudjida et al., A reconfigurable counter controller for digital motion control application, Microelectronics J., vol. 28, no. 6–7, p.683–690, 1997.

DOI: 10.1016/s0026-2692(97)00009-8

Google Scholar

[6] F. Thomas et al., Design and implementation of a wheel speed measurement circuit using field programmable gate arrays in a spacecraft,Microprocessors and Microsyst., p.553–560, 1999.

DOI: 10.1016/s0141-9331(98)00092-1

Google Scholar

[7] K. I. Kim et al., Design of a biped robot using DSP and FPGA, in Proc. FIRA Robot World Congr., 2002, p.698–701.

Google Scholar

[8] A. Kongmunvattana and P. Chongstivatana, A FPGA-based behavioral control system for a mobile robot, in Proc. IEEE Asia-Pacific Conf. Circuits Syst, Nov. 1998, p.759–762.

DOI: 10.1109/apccas.1998.743932

Google Scholar

[9] Seul Jung and Sung su Kim, Hardware Implementation of a Real-Time Neural Network Controller With a DSP and an FPGA for Nonlinear Systems, IEEE TRANSACTIONS ON INDUSTRIAL ELECTRONICS, VOL. 54, NO. 1, FEBRUARY 2007, pp.265-271

DOI: 10.1109/tie.2006.888791

Google Scholar